Plagnals is a locality in Sauze di Cesana, Province of Turin, Piedmont and has an elevation of 1,916 metres. Plagnals is situated nearby to the hamlet Grange Sises, as well as near the locality Colle Sestriere.Places of Interest

Sestriere is a ski resort in Piedmont, Italy, a comune of the Metropolitan City of Turin. It is situated in Val Susa, 17 km from the French border. Its name derives from Latin: ad petram sistrariam, that is at sixty Roman miles from Turin.
